2012:23 Samlad strålsäkerhetsvärdering av hälso- och sjukvården
Landstingen lever inte upp till Strålsäkerhetsmyndighetens krav när det gäller strålsäkerhet. Det innebär att det inom hälso- och sjukvården finns brister i strålsäkerheten som kan leda till allvarliga konsekvenser för patienter och personal. Det visar Strålsäkerhetsmyndighetens sammanställning av nio inspekterade landsting.
